Graphic: The 1460 Pascal is an 8-eye silhouette based on the original Dr. Martens boot
Origin: Vietnam
Material: Leather
Serves up classic Doc's DNA, like scripted heel-loop, grooved sides and yellow stitching
Made with backhand, a full-grain, soft comfort leather
Built on the iconic Dr. Martens air-cushioned sole

I never thought I'd buy a pair of these for myself, but I'm really glad I did. I got my normal size, 13, and they do feel about half a size too large, just kinda loose in the ankle. If you tie them tight though it's not really a problem. Extremely comfy and warm straight out of the box, I would definitely advise some nice and decently long socks to wear with them though. Short socks will just give you a nasty sore on your ankles. I bought a pack of merino wool People's socks and they have been wonderful the last two weeks as well; keep your feet even warmer. The Aztec crazyhorse color is very nice, it isn't really loud like some other colors of Docs can be, and it goes with almost anything. Will likely be decently waterproof if you put some kind of treatment on the leather, but out of the box they still seem to keep out anything shy of stepping in a puddle. Will definitely buy again provided they hold up like they should.
